570 Winscar Reservoir

Cook's Study is an odd name for a hill. But on this rounded summit, west of Winscar Reservoir, the famous sculptor Sir Francis Chantry built a watchtower. Later Mr Cook hijacked the folly for his studies - hence the name. The tower alas is long gone, but the hill is still a splendid viewpoint.

LOCATION: Twenty miles east of Manchester
START: Winscar Reservoir car park. Turn off the A628, 4 miles beyond Crowden, signed Trans Pennine Trail.
Grid ref: SE153019 Postcode: S36 4TE
DISTANCE: 6.5 miles
GRADE: Moderate, rough moorland walking
TIME: 4 hours
MAP: Explorer OL - Dark Peak Landranger 110
REFRESHMENTS: Pack a flask
EN ROUTE: River Don, Dearden, Snailsden, Harden , Dunford Bridge
